Koder is a free, open-source code editor with support for syntax highlighting for over 200 languages and themed interface customization. It is cross-platform with versions available for Windows, Linux, and macOS.

Virtkick is a virtual machine management platform designed for managing VMs in the cloud or on-premises. It provides a simple yet powerful interface for provisioning, monitoring, and managing VMs across multiple hypervisors.
